Some little known facts about Oxford (from http://www.oxfordsleepout.moonfruit.com/)...
FACT: There are 580 emergency bed spaces in Oxford
FACT: 30-50% of rough sleepers have mental health needs
FACT: A 2002 study showed that 70% of rough sleepers misuse drugs, and half are dependent on alcohol
FACT: 37% of homeless people have no qualifications
FACT: The life expectancy of someone sleeping rough is estimated at 42 years
FACT: Homeless people are 13 times more likely to be the victims of violence
FACT: 1 in 20 young people across the UK are likely to be homeless at some point in their lives
FACT: The most common causes of homelessness are debt, relationship break down, loss of job, bereavement, leaving the armed forces, mental health, domestic violence and substance misuse
